在数字化时代,视频内容已成为人们获取信息、娱乐休闲的重要方式。HTML5视频播放器因其跨平台、易实现的特性,成为了网页开发中的热门选择。今天,就让我们一起来打造一个个性化的HTML5视频播放器,并通过简单的网页源码教学与实操,让视频播放器在您的网页中焕发光彩。
了解HTML5视频播放器的基本原理
HTML5 视频播放器主要依赖于 <video> 标签实现。这个标签允许网页直接嵌入视频,而无需任何插件。以下是 <video> 标签的一些基本属性:
src:指定视频文件的路径。controls:显示视频控件,如播放、暂停、音量等。autoplay:视频加载就自动播放。loop:视频播放结束后自动循环。
选择合适的视频格式
在制作HTML5视频播放器之前,需要选择合适的视频格式。目前,以下几种格式在网页中较为常见:
- MP4:这是最常用的视频格式,几乎所有的浏览器都支持。
- WebM:这是Google推出的格式,也获得了广泛支持。
- OGG:这是一种开放的视频格式,但支持度相对较低。
创建HTML5视频播放器的基本结构
下面是一个简单的HTML5视频播放器的基本结构:
<video id="myVideo" controls>
<source src="movie.mp4" type="video/mp4">
您的浏览器不支持视频标签。
</video>
这段代码创建了一个名为 myVideo 的视频播放器,并指定了视频文件的路径和格式。如果用户的浏览器不支持视频标签,将显示一条提示信息。
添加自定义样式
为了使视频播放器更具个性化,我们可以添加一些CSS样式。以下是一个简单的示例:
#myVideo {
width: 100%;
height: auto;
}
这段CSS代码将视频播放器的宽度设置为100%,高度自适应,从而使视频播放器在页面中居中显示。
添加JavaScript交互
为了增强视频播放器的交互性,我们可以使用JavaScript。以下是一个简单的示例:
document.getElementById("myVideo").addEventListener("play", function() {
alert("视频开始播放!");
});
这段JavaScript代码在视频开始播放时弹出一个提示框。
个性化设计
为了打造个性化的HTML5视频播放器,我们可以从以下几个方面入手:
- 主题定制:通过修改CSS样式,为视频播放器设置不同的主题。
- 控件定制:自定义播放器控件,如按钮、进度条等。
- 动画效果:添加动画效果,使视频播放器更具动感。
实操步骤
- 创建HTML文件:使用文本编辑器创建一个HTML文件,并按照上述示例编写代码。
- 上传视频文件:将视频文件上传到服务器或云存储平台,并修改
<source>标签中的src属性。 - 测试播放器:在浏览器中打开HTML文件,查看视频播放器是否正常工作。
- 个性化设计:根据需求,修改CSS和JavaScript代码,为视频播放器添加个性化设计。
通过以上教学与实操,相信您已经能够打造一个属于自己的个性化HTML5视频播放器。接下来,不妨发挥创意,为您的网页增添更多精彩吧!
